A community art project that saw art displayed at Garston railway station has been shortlisted for a national award.
Groundwork Hertfordshire worked with pupils from Berry Grove Primary School and Francis Combe Academy to design and create pictures to be put up along the station platform.
More than 60 local residents also created seven large wooden painted sculptures that now line the footpath outside the station.
This work has now earned two nominations – in the categories of involving young people and community art schemes – at the Association of Community Rail Partners Community Rail Awards.
The winners will be announced on September 24.
